Boyle County, Kentucky — FY2016
In fiscal year 2016, Boyle County, Kentucky received $0.3M across 42 payment records. That is $10.73 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ates. ▼ 6.4% vs. FY2015
Programs in FY2016
| Rank | Program | Total | Records |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| RURAL RENTAL ASSISTANCE PAYMENTS 10.427 | $162K | 4 |
| 2 | LIVESTOCK INDEMNITY PROGRAM-2014 FARM BILL 10.108 | $83K | 13 |
| 3 | AGRICULTURE RISK COVERAGE PROGRAM 10.113 | $65K | 17 |
| 4 | CONSERVATION RESERVE PROGRAM 10.069 | $12K | 8 |
